I work as an Environmental Manager, and have seen what happens to the paper waste. They dump it all into a big pulper and mash it up, bleach it and then recycle it.
Doubt a couple of boogers would throw much of a spanner in the works

anyway there are 2 bins, 1 for paper, plastic, metal and card and another for everything else.
i was at the site the other day and the things out of the recycling bin that gets wasted is very minimal, its just a few things that the machines dont recognise as anything else.
the stuff out the normal bins gets insinerated. the heat used to burn it creates loads of electricity (i cant remember the figures) and it creates practically no polution at all (less than the damage caused by a 5min fire work desplay in a whole year)
i cant understand why the brits are so against incinoration its so much better than land fill
